The Spa is a sitcom created, written and starring Derren Litten broadcast by Sky Living. It is set in a health spa in Hertfordshire and follows the daily goings-on of the business. The first series consisted of seven episodes and aired between February and March 2013. A New Year Special concluded the series on 27 December 2013.

Background[edit]

The Spa follows the daily running of a health club where a run in with the staff can be deadly. The spa is run by bossy manageress Alison Crabbe, who is confident she can turn the spa into a successful business, despite a series of unfortunate accidents and terrible customer service. Alison is joined by an eccentric and inept group of employees who find themselves in strange and bizarre situations as a matter of routine.

Episodes[edit]

Episode Title Directed by Written by Ratings[1] Original air date
1"High Anxiety"Sandy JohnsonDerren Litten532,0007 February 2013 (2013-02-07)
It's a typically abnormal day at The Spa as Rose goes to great heights to get noticed and Sally suffers the consequences of upsetting fussy regular Ms Begita Wylde.
2"No Place Like Home"Sandy JohnsonDerren Litten378,00014 February 2013 (2013-02-14)
Alison secretly moves into the health centre when her boiler at home breaks down, but it's far from a relaxing stay.
3"A Rose Is A Rose Is A Rose"Sandy JohnsonDerren Litten320,00021 February 2013 (2013-02-21)
Marcus suspects his boss is to blame for his injury and although Alison has tried to put him off the scent, he's on the hunt for evidence.
4"Love Is A Losing Game"Sandy JohnsonDerren Litten318,00028 February 2013 (2013-02-28)
Peter Kelly, a swindler from Alison's past, uses his smooth-yet-slimy talking gets the manageress on board with his latest scheme to break into the PR world.
5"Wedding Belles"Sandy JohnsonDerren Litten241,0007 March 2013 (2013-03-07)
Both wedding and alarm bells sound as manageress Alison gets her registrar licence.
6"Mr Right"Sandy JohnsonDerren Litten255,00014 March 2013 (2013-03-14)
Davina confides in Vron about her crush on Marcus, only to receive some surprising information in return. Meanwhile Alison is looking for love.
7"Guilty Until Proven Innocent"Sandy JohnsonDerren Litten225,00021 March 2013 (2013-03-21)
The first series of the comedy concludes with Marcus and Alison's long-awaited showdown. Chesney Hawkes guest stars.
8"Strangers In The Night"Sandy JohnsonDerren LittenUnder 121,00027 December 2013 (2013-12-27)
Its New Year's Eve and staff are hoping to be dismissed early. There's no such luck, unfortunately, due to a freak snow storm.
